Gasquet, Robredo advance early in Toronto


Toronto, ON (Sports Network) - Richard Gasquet and Tommy Robredo cruised into the second round on Monday at the $2,615,000 Rogers Masters in Toronto.

The Frenchman and 10-seed Gasquet faced a bit of a challenge from countryman Michael Llodra, but prevailed 6-2, 4-6, 6-3.

Despite a tough opening set, Robredo, the 12th-seed from Spain, dispatched Frederic Niemeyer of Canada, 7-6 (7-4), 6-1 to gain the second round. The Canadian did manage to out-ace the victor by a 10-3 margin.

Nine-seed Swiss Stanislas Wawrinka bested Simone Bolelli in a 6-4, 7-6 (7-4) duel; 14th-ranked Chilean Fernando Gonzalez breezed by Julien Benneteau of France, 6-2, 6-1 and Russian 15-seed Mikhail Youzhny won in straight sets over Andreas Seppi from Italy 7-6 (7-1), 6-2.

One upset from Monday's action came in the late match, as Spaniard Feliciano Lopez upended 11th-seeded Czech Radek Stepanek 4-6, 6-3, 6-4.

In other action on the hardcourt, American Robby Ginepri sank Paul-Henri Mathieu 6-3, 4-6, 6-4; Argentine Jose Acasuso recorded a comeback 6-7 (1-7), 6-3, 7-5 decision over Latvian Ernests Gulbis; Nicolas Mahut outlasted Janko Tipsarevic 6-3, 6-7 (5-7), 6-2; Germany's Nicolas Kiefer sent down American Mardy Fish 7-5, 7-6 (7-4), and Canadian wild card Frank Dancevic easily topped Croat Mario Ancic 6-3, 6-4.
